Role summary

This is a full-time, temporary Executive Support Officer role at Yorkshire Ambulance Service NHS Trust, providing high-level, confidential administrative support to the Executive Director of Finance. The role involves managing complex diaries and inboxes, drafting reports, coordinating meetings, and contributing to service improvement. It offers a unique opportunity to gain insight into executive-level operations within a large NHS organisation. The ideal candidate is highly organised, proactive, professional, and proficient in digital tools.

Useful to know

Band 5 pay context

Agenda for Change 2024/25 pays Band 5 at £29,970 – £36,483 a year, across England.

This advert: £32,073 – £39,043 — outside the standard scale; check for HCAS/London weighting.
